hello there, i am new in laser world and in this community also.
I have one issue that i want to share with you.I am runnung Bystronic Byvention 3015,and i have some problems with tool radius compensation.During the cutting process i am allowed to change tool compensation, but sometimes the result is ,that machine cuts some contours that don`t exist on drawings .The explanation of the Bystronic guys was that CNC gets confused if the tool compensation is changed while cutting contours.They say that i should change TRC only when i stop and wait for few seconds after it .As i understand the other machines by Bystronic are operated by Byvision ,and there you can change even parameters during cutting.So what is your opinion on this ?Is this normal for all Bystronic machines or this is issue that this certain controller has.Do you change TRC on your Bystronic while cutting?

No not all Bystronic machines. The Byvention was designed to "set and forget". The problem is the little controller is limited and you have to change most parameters via laptop networked to the machine. Bysoft/Parameditor. TRC may change with different materials and heat expansion. Focus could create issues with TRC as well, a deeper focus may need adjustment. -HR
